Route Manager (Chesapeake)
- Provide first line supervision to Route Logistics team members at one of the market locations
- Ensure route logistics efficiency through appropriate interaction with market employees and route analysis
- Maintain safe and secure environment with the goal of ensuring that all Route Logistics employees work and return home safely
- Leverage systems, equipment and process redesign to drive continuous improvement in cost, quality and efficiency
- Maintain and provide quality customer service
- Secure inventories by executing controls and ensuring strict compliance with security procedures; proactively reduce risk exposure and ensure implementation of measures to reduce worker's compensation injury costs and security losses
- Establish and maintain accountability on the front line of the market; schedule and develop staff; maintain positive Employee Relations and work environment, while creating a cooperative team atmosphere of employee engagement
- Maintain the highest level of integrity, dignity and standards both on an internal and external basis; maintain high ethical standards and protect the Brink's reputation by delivering high quality, reliable programs and services which meet customer expectations
- Minimum of 3 years operations experience in transportation and/or logistics
- Minimum of 1 year supervisory experience
- Minimum of Class B with air brakes driver's license
- Satisfy all applicable Department of Transportation requirements
- Minimum of 21 years of age
- A valid firearms permit or ability to pass applicable firearms licensing requirements
- A valid guard card or ability to obtain a guard card or any other required licenses
- Able to lift at least 50 pounds
- 5+ years ATM operations and claims experience
- Previous experience as an armored car driver
- Knowledge of route analysis and logistics
- Knowledge of lean/process improvement methodologies
- Knowledge of budgeting and planning experience
- Bachelor's Degree
- Strong consultative, analytical and problem solving skills
- Excellent interpersonal/communication and presentation skills
